Q: How do I gain eCPD?
Certificates will be emailed to delegates approximately 6-8 weeks after the show. Make sure you get scanned into every theatre session you attend to ensure all your eCPD is recorded. You will need to remain in the theatre for the duration of the session to gain the full amount of time - if you leave a session early, you will only gain the amount of time that you attended the session for. If you arrive more than 15 minutes after a session has started, you may not be awarded CPD for that session, so please do arrive in plenty of time for your chosen sessions.

Q: Can I bring my children?
A: There is a strict no minor's (under the age of 18 years old) policy. The Dentistry Show Birmingham remains a clinical and trade event for dental and allied trade professionals only. Please make alternative arrangements for childcare as there is no provision at the NEC Birmingham. Due to the nature of the event and the types of products showcased, this is something we have to regulate.
